If you're growing this fast now , ( just my thoughts & opinions) maybe you should start scaling up now / looking for someone to join , perhaps figure out some type of basic method / system to detailing the cars, then when they're able to detail on there own it will be your way and your expectations of a finished job etc... Perhaps offer 30% pay of that job (if they upsell they make more and you do too..) + they keep tips...... if you decide to hire another person you have your " basic method / system to detailing and your helper can train the new person should you decide to get another taking more of the load off you.... Maybe adjust your prices accordingly now while you're still fresh instead of later when you have a lot more established customers , the hit wont be so bad.... Just thoughts , random ideas I've thought about personally.
